The #QuitGPT Movement: OpenAI Faces Global Backlash After Landmark Pentagon Deal A massive storm has struck OpenAI this week following confirmed reports that CEO Sam Altman has finalized a multi-billion dollar contract with the U.S. Department of Defense (Pentagon) . The deal, which integrates ChatGPT technology into national security networks, has ignited a global wildfire of protest under the hashtag #QuitGPT , with users accusing the company of "selling its soul" to the military-industrial complex. The Catalyst: Security vs. Survival The controversy was fueled by a sharp contrast in corporate values. While its primary rival, Anthropic , was banned by the U.S. government for refusing to strip away its AI safety "guardrails," OpenAI chose a different path.
